Default KQs from EP

I only have like 5 hands on the dude, so not much of a read at all.

I believe i missplayed the turn here. Anything that he raises here, I'm probably behind. Don't really know why i called down though. any comments suggestions are appreciated.

Party Poker 0.5/1 Hold'em (10 handed) converter

Preflop: Hero is UTG+2 with K[img]/images/graemlins/heart.gif[/img], Q[img]/images/graemlins/heart.gif[/img].
<font color="#666666">1 fold</font>, UTG+1 calls, <font color="#CC3333">Hero raises</font>, <font color="#666666">4 folds</font>, <font color="#CC3333">Button 3-bets</font>, <font color="#666666">1 fold</font>, BB calls, UTG+1 calls, Hero calls.

Flop: (12.50 SB) 3[img]/images/graemlins/heart.gif[/img], Q[img]/images/graemlins/club.gif[/img], 2[img]/images/graemlins/diamond.gif[/img] <font color="#0000FF">(4 players)</font>
BB checks, UTG+1 checks, Hero checks, <font color="#CC3333">Button bets</font>, BB calls, UTG+1 folds, <font color="#CC3333">Hero raises</font>, <font color="#CC3333">Button 3-bets</font>, BB calls, <font color="#CC3333">Hero caps</font>, Button calls, BB calls.

Turn: (12.25 BB) 4[img]/images/graemlins/club.gif[/img] <font color="#0000FF">(3 players)</font>
BB checks, <font color="#CC3333">Hero bets</font>, <font color="#CC3333">Button raises</font>, BB folds, Hero calls.

River: (16.25 BB) 4[img]/images/graemlins/diamond.gif[/img] <font color="#0000FF">(2 players)</font>
Hero checks, <font color="#CC3333">Button bets</font>, Hero calls.

Final Pot: 18.25 BB

I call the flop three bet and fold the turn unimproved. There is almost no hand that he three bets preflop, on the flop, and then raises you on the turn that you are beating. Since you called the turn, I would check/fold the river.

I call the flop three bet and fold the turn unimproved.

Yeah this is okay if we have him on AA-QQ/AQ since we have about 7.5% equity against that range of hands.. If he can have other hands, then calling on 4th street (or calling down) is prudent.
